What is 52/53 Divided By 2/5

Answer: 5253÷25\frac{52}{53}\div\frac{2}{5} = 13053\frac{130}{53}

Solving 5253÷25\frac{52}{53}\div\frac{2}{5}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

5253÷25=5253×52\frac{52}{53} \div \frac{2}{5} = \frac{52}{53} \times \frac{5}{2}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 52×5=26052 \times 5 = 260
  • Multiply the Denominators: 53×2=10653 \times 2 = 106
  • Form the New Fraction: 5253×25=260106\frac{52}{53} \times \frac{2}{5} = \frac{260}{106}

Let's Simplify 260106\frac{260}{106}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 260260 and 106106. The GCD of 260260 and 106106 is 22.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:260÷2106÷2=13053\frac{260 \div 2}{106 \div 2} = \frac{130}{53}

Answer 5253÷25=13053\frac{52}{53}\div\frac{2}{5} = \frac{130}{53}
